Description

Job Description:

Leidos has an exciting opportunity for a Geospatial SME to join our team to support a highly visible, fast-paced U.S. Army program. The Geospatial SME will also serve as the business development lead for Geospatial programs. This position requires an active TS/SCI clearance.

As the Geospatial SME you will providing technical and analytical support to address issues such as environmental management, exploration, mining, etc. Providing technical leadership and for delivering an innovative product, service or, at higher levels, a combination of products and services that address a customer's specific business problem. Must have an understanding of the geospatial environment, Army requirements and developing long-range and strategic plans, and identifying strategies and weakness of business opportunities for the corporation.

The Geospatial SME works with the team (internal and external) to deliver guidance, plans and integration with other DoD and Army systems and requirements.
